Unless you begin to "hack" your iPhone, in all honesty I wouldn't worry
about it and there aren't system-wide antivirus apps designed for the
iPhone. They aren't really needed. Since each app is kept in its own sandbox
and cannot access anything else on your device aside from specific API hooks
(i.e. when an app asks for permission to access your contacts), and since
all code is signed and approved by Apple, the chances of malicious code
being able to run on your device are very slim. The security model of iOS
means that it's just about the most secure type of platform you'll ever see.
